Wednesday, 24 July 2013
21st Sitting of the Foreign Affairs Committee
At the sitting held on 24 July, the members of the Foreign Affairs Committee conducted an interview with Danilo Vucetic, Ambassador of the Republic of Serbia to the Republic of Turkey, before deployment for diplomatic duty.
The Committee went on to adopt the Bill on the Confirmation of the Agreement between the Republic of Serbia and Montenegro on Reciprocal Representation and Provision of Consular Protection and Services in Third Countries, elaborated by representatives of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
The Committee members also reviewed and accepted the initiative for a visit of representatives of the Security Services Control Committee to Geneva to discuss future cooperation and visit to its counterpart committee in the Swiss Parliament, from 15 to 20 September 2013, extended by the Geneva Centre for the Democratic Control of Armed Forces.
The Committee also accepted the invitation extended to the Chairperson of the National Assembly’s Security Services Control Committee to take part in the first meeting of the chairpersons of the defence and security committees of South-East European countries in charge of supervising military intelligence services in Split, from 24 to 26 September 2013, as well as the invitation extended to the Head of the National Assembly’s standing delegation to PABSEC, Predrag Markovic, to the 4th International Black Sea Economic Forum - Common Points and Cooperation between Black Sea Region Countries, organised by the Council of Ministers of the Autonomous Republic of Crimea, from 24 to 25 October 2013.
The Committee noted the standing delegations’ regular activities in the upcoming period and adopted the reports on visits and contacts realised.
The Committee members also noted the amendments and modifications to the membership of the parliamentary friendship groups with the US, Germany, UK, Kuwait and Sovereign Order of Malta.
The sitting was chaired by Irena Vujovic, Deputy Committee Chairperson.
